Run Drupal tests from the shell.
|
114 |
|
|
|
115 |
|
|
Usage: {$args['script']} [OPTIONS] <tests>
|
116 |
|
|
Example: {$args['script']} Profile
|
117 |
|
|
|
118 |
|
|
All arguments are long options.
|
119 |
|
|
|
120 |
|
|
--help Print this page.
|
121 |
|
|
|
122 |
|
|
--list Display all available test groups.
|
123 |
|
|
|
124 |
|
|
--clean Cleans up database tables or directories from previous, failed,
|
125 |
|
|
tests and then exits (no tests are run).
|
126 |
|
|
|
127 |
|
|
--url Immediately precedes a URL to set the host and path. You will
|
128 |
|
|
need this parameter if Drupal is in a subdirectory on your
|
129 |
|
|
localhost and you have not set \$base_url in settings.php. Tests
|
130 |
|
|
can be run under SSL by including https:// in the URL.
|
131 |
|
|
|
132 |
|
|
--php The absolute path to the PHP executable. Usually not needed.
|
133 |
|
|
|
134 |
|
|
--concurrency [num]
|
135 |
|
|
|
136 |
|
|
Run tests in parallel, up to [num] tests at a time.
|
137 |
|
|
|
138 |
|
|
--all Run all available tests.
|
139 |
|
|
|
140 |
|
|
--class Run tests identified by specific class names, instead of group names.
|
141 |
|
|
|
142 |
|
|
--file Run tests identified by specific file names, instead of group names.
|
143 |
|
|
Specify the path and the extension (i.e. 'modules/user/user.test').
|
144 |
|
|
|
145 |
|
|
--xml <path>
|
146 |
|
|
|
147 |
|
|
If provided, test results will be written as xml files to this path.
|
148 |
|
|
|
149 |
|
|
--color Output text format results with color highlighting.
|
150 |
|
|
|
151 |
|
|
--verbose Output detailed assertion messages in addition to summary.
|
152 |
|
|
|
153 |
|
|
<test1>[,<test2>[,<test3> ...]]
|
154 |
|
|
|
155 |
|
|
One or more tests to be run. By default, these are interpreted
|
156 |
|
|
as the names of test groups as shown at
|
157 |
|
|
?q=admin/config/development/testing.
|
158 |
|
|
These group names typically correspond to module names like "User"
|
159 |
|
|
or "Profile" or "System", but there is also a group "XML-RPC".
|
160 |
|
|
If --class is specified then these are interpreted as the names of
|
161 |
|
|
specific test classes whose test methods will be run. Tests must
|
162 |
|
|
be separated by commas. Ignored if --all is specified.
|
163 |
|
|
|
164 |
|
|
To run this script you will normally invoke it from the root directory of your
|
165 |
|
|
Drupal installation as the webserver user (differs per configuration), or root:
|
166 |
|
|
|
167 |
|
|
sudo -u [wwwrun|www-data|etc] php ./scripts/{$args['script']}
|
168 |
|
|
--url http://example.com/ --all
|
169 |
|
|
sudo -u [wwwrun|www-data|etc] php ./scripts/{$args['script']}
|
170 |
|
|
--url http://example.com/ --class BlockTestCase
